Prince Harry speaks out against Fortnite; says it should be banned

Prince Harry is speaking out against the popular game Fortnite and calling for its ban, according to The Daily Express.
The Duke of Sussex visited a YMCA in West London recently where he made the statement. He also said the game is more addictive than alcohol and drugs.
He says: “The game shouldn’t be allowed. It’s created to addict.
“An addiction to keep you in front of a computer for as long as possible. It’s so irresponsible.”
Prince Harry urges parents to take action and have their children interact more with the outside world, while also acknowledging that many parents don’t know how to solve the dilemma.
“Parents have got their hands up – they don’t know what to do about it,” he says. “It’s like waiting for the damage to be done.”

The Duke also emphasised the dangers of reliance on social media to form connections.
“It’s more dangerous because it’s normalized and there are no restrictions to it,” Prince Harry stresses, referring to social media. “We are in a mind-altering time.”
He continues: “Without that human connection when you do have a problem you have nowhere to go.
. “The only place you might go is online and you will probably end up getting bullied.”
